About

Y.L. Verschoor is a scholar working on Oncology,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Y.L. Verschoor has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 287 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Oncology, 5 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 4 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Y.L. Verschoor's work include Colorectal Cancer Treatments and Studies (8 papers), Cancer Immunotherapy and Biomarkers (7 papers) and Genetic factors in colorectal cancer (5 papers). Y.L. Verschoor is often cited by papers focused on Colorectal Cancer Treatments and Studies (8 papers), Cancer Immunotherapy and Biomarkers (7 papers) and Genetic factors in colorectal cancer (5 papers). Y.L. Verschoor coll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, United States and Switzerland. Y.L. Verschoor's co-authors include Myriam Chalabi, Monique E. van Leerdam, Ton N. Schumacher, Steven J. Oosterling, Geerard L. Beets, Hendrik A. Marsman, Regina G. H. Beets‐Tan, Karolina Sikorska, J.B.A.G. Haanen and John B.A.G. Haanen and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Nature Medicine and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
